Comparative Overview of Microsoft Surface Devices: Surface Book vs. Surface Pro

Professionals involved in design, engineering, fashion, and creative fields often seek powerful laptops with exceptional graphics, fast processing, and long-lasting battery life. The Microsoft Surface lineup, especially the Surface Book series, offers top-tier features tailored for such demanding tasks. These laptops feature robust configurations, including Intel Core i7 processors, ample RAM, dedicated GPUs, large displays, and extended battery performance, making them ideal for 3D modeling, CAD, and multimedia work.

Designed for flexibility, the Surface Book stands out with its detachable screen and high-performance components. It supports Windows 10 S, optimized for better efficiency on lower hardware. Perfect for students and professionals alike, it delivers smooth multitasking and creative workflows. While it shares some similarities with premium devices like the MacBook, its price point is higher, reflecting its advanced capabilities.

Another notable device is the Surface Pro, an upgrade from the 2015 Surface Pro 4. Launched as "the tablet that can replace a laptop," this 2-in-1 device offers versatility for users needing both tablet and laptop functionalities. Its lightweight and customizable design make it ideal for travelers and creative professionals. The Surface Pro competes with the Apple iPad Pro, though hardware specs and operating system preferences influence user choice. Overall, these devices cater to users seeking performance, portability, and flexibility in their computing experience.
